Mengatasi Masalah "php artisan make:auth" Tidak Ditemukan di Laravel 6
Laravel 6 adalah salah satu versi populer dari framework PHP Laravel. Namun, dalam beberapa kasus, pengguna mungkin mengalami masalah saat menjalankan perintah "php artisan make:auth" di Laravel 6, di mana perintah tersebut tidak ditemukan. Dalam blog ini, kami akan membahas penyebab dan solusi untuk masalah ini agar Anda dapat melanjutkan pengembangan aplikasi Laravel 6 dengan lancar.
Bagian 1: Perubahan pada Laravel 6
Langkah 1: Periksa versi Laravel yang Anda gunakan dengan menjalankan perintah berikut di terminal:
#bash
macbookpro@MBP-Macbook ~ % php artisan --version
Langkah 2: Jika versi Laravel Anda adalah 6.x, maka ada perubahan signifikan pada struktur dan fitur Laravel dibandingkan dengan versi sebelumnya. Perintah "php artisan make:auth" tidak lagi tersedia secara langsung di Laravel 6.
Bagian 2: Solusi Alternatif
Langkah 1: Jika Anda ingin menggunakan fitur otentikasi yang tersedia di Laravel 6, Anda dapat menggunakan perintah "composer require laravel/ui" untuk menginstal paket laravel/ui yang menyediakan perintah-perintah otentikasi.
Langkah 2: Jalankan perintah berikut di terminal untuk menginstal paket laravel/ui:
#bash
macbookpro@MBP-Macbook ~ % composer require laravel/ui
Langkah 3: Setelah proses instalasi selesai, jalankan perintah berikut untuk menghasilkan tampilan dan rute otentikasi:
bash
macbookpro@MBP-Macbook ~ % php artisan ui vue --auth
Anda juga dapat mengganti "vue" dengan "bootstrap" jika Anda ingin menggunakan tampilan dengan framework Bootstrap.
Bagian 3: Menyesuaikan Manual
Langkah 1: Jika Anda lebih memilih untuk menyesuaikan secara manual fitur otentikasi di Laravel 6, Anda dapat membuat tampilan dan rute otentikasi sendiri.
Langkah 2: Buatlah tampilan dan rute yang diperlukan untuk fitur otentikasi seperti halaman login, registrasi, pengaturan profil, dan lainnya.
Langkah 3: Anda juga perlu menentukan pengontrol (controller) yang mengelola logika untuk setiap tindakan otentikasi, seperti masuk, keluar, mendaftar, dan lainnya.
Kesimpulan:
Dalam blog ini, kami telah membahas masalah "php artisan make:auth" yang tidak ditemukan di Laravel 6. Jika Anda menghadapi masalah ini, kami merekomendasikan menggunakan solusi alternatif dengan menginstal paket laravel/ui dan menggunakan perintah "php artisan ui" untuk menghasilkan tampilan dan rute otentikasi.
Anda juga dapat memilih untuk menyesuaikan secara manual fitur otentikasi dengan membuat tampilan, rute, dan pengontrol yang diperlukan.
Terima kasih telah membaca blog ini. Dengan menggunakan solusi yang dijelaskan di atas, Anda dapat melanjutkan pengembangan aplikasi Laravel 6 dengan fitur otentikasi yang sesuai dengan kebutuhan Anda.
Tidak ada komentar:
Posting Komentar